Landscape Policy: Making a Difference

On Thursday 15th June the Centre for Landscape hosted an online, expert seminar and discussion on landscape policy. The aim was to to develop skills and understanding of policy engagements and related impacts.

The event considered two key questions:

how best to connect with landscape policy makers?

how to write effective science policy briefing notes?

This expert seminar was led and introduced by Centre co-director Prof. Maggie Roe, and featured presentations from invited external experts on national and international landscape policy to consider examples of best practice and strategies for engagement. These were followed by a Q&A discussion.
